Moms marshmallow cream fruit dip Recipe

Ingredients:

8 oz cream cheese
1 large (or 2 small) containers of marshmallow cream
nutmeg

Directions:

Soften cream cheese. Gently fold in the marshmallow cream until well mixed (not overmixed or it will beat out the fluffiness). Sprinkle some nutmeg in.
Serve with fresh fruit - strawberries, melon, pineapple, grapes, peaches, etc. Toothpicks are useful to dip the fruit with.
